Output 89606f8a3ffc910db18160c611621aa26c9bbb0a361af4837c408c02a7d1e184:1

value
29631
script pubkey
OP_0 OP_PUSHBYTES_20 ba605bdc3dac31583d883a068753b373dbf8a3ae
address
tb1qhfs9hhpa4sc4s0vg8grgw5anw0dl3gawuvsq7u
transaction
89606f8a3ffc910db18160c611621aa26c9bbb0a361af4837c408c02a7d1e184